The novel is told by a religious, overweight African American young man, dealing with his homosexuality. His journey takes us through his teenage marriage, parenting, and how he leads a double life to control his gayness, including a form of gay conversion therapy. Well written although the characters and story feel superficial.

Another book with a great hook-Right off the bat we meet Eddie, a young African American who has been terribly injured resulting in the loss of both his hands. The novel backtracks as to how this happened along with a first person narrative of an invisible drug dealer that ruins the life of Eddie's mother Darlene. The resolution is beautifully developed but the journey getting there is way too long. An editor should have had the author trim a good junk of the book.
